The chart below highlights five key roles in retail waste reduction and their respective market shares: 1. **Waste Reduction Analyst**: These professionals focus on identifying, analyzing, and reducing waste within a retail business. Their role involves monitoring waste management systems and implementing strategies to improve efficiency and sustainability. 2. **Sustainability Consultant**: Sustainability consultants work with retail organizations to develop and implement sustainable practices and initiatives. They help businesses reduce their environmental impact, save costs, and meet regulatory requirements. 3. **Environmental Engineer**: Environmental engineers are responsible for designing, implementing, and monitoring waste reduction and recycling systems. They may work on projects related to water and air pollution control, waste management, and public health. 4. **Supply Chain Specialist**: Supply chain specialists focus on optimizing retail supply chains to minimize waste and reduce environmental impact. They work closely with suppliers, manufacturers, and logistics providers to improve efficiency and sustainability. 5. **Compliance Manager**: Compliance managers ensure that retail organizations adhere to environmental regulations and standards. They develop, implement, and monitor compliance programs, and may also provide training and guidance to employees.
